The Honor V30 & V30 Pro series phones recently get the Magic 3.0.1.169 update, bringing a series of new features.
This update adds knuckle gesture operation, using single finger joints can quickly take screenshots and split screens, and using two knuckles can start screen recording, and users are recommended to update.

Honor released the V30 and V30 Pro, the first 5G phones by the company powered by the Kirin 990 chipset and come with five cameras on November 26, 2019.
The devices pack 6.57” LCDs of Full HD+ resolution. The fingerprint scanner is on the side just as on the Honor 20 and Honor 20 Pro. The back features a large elevate piece in the corner that hosts the triple camera setup.
The Honor V30 has Kirin 990 chipset onboard along with Balong 5000 5G modem for 5G connectivity, while the Honor V30 Pro is driven by the 7nm Kirin 990 5G which is integrated with a 5G modem.
Both phones come with 40 MP main cameras and share the main 40MP Sony IMX600 sensor with Dual OIS and laser AF, but the Pro version has a faster F/1.6 lens compared to the F/1.8 optics on the V30.
After the Huawei 5G conference officially launched HMS services and the App Gallery application store overseas, Honor also released the Honor V30 Pro mobile phone at the European conference.
It has a built-in App Gallery application store and Huawei Assistant, and will be available for sale in the Russian market for the first time on March 3.
